Pooling for the Lanternfish API is handled by PoolMaster, not the app. Max pool size is 40; do not raise it without checking replica lag on the Brightwater cluster. If connections pile up, restart the pooler first, never the primary. Rotation of the pooler's admin credential happens quarterly. After rotating, update every worker host before restarting, or they will thrash reconnecting. Put this line in the pooler's env file on each host:

secret setting of yajog-taguf: ARCHIVE_KEY3=051

Welcome aboard! One of the first things you'll touch is the CSV Import Wizard inside Tallyloft, our ledger tool. The wizard lives in the ingest repo and talks to an internal service called ColumnCruncher, which handles header detection and type inference so we don't have to. Locally, you can run the wizard against the staging instance — it's forgiving and resets nightly, so don't worry about breaking anything. To get requests past the gateway, drop the key below into your local env file.

app token of kafop-hahaf = kto11_iRLdsMBafGn

## Catalog Cache Invalidation

For the weekly eng sync: the Brindlemart product catalog uses a write-through cache with event-driven invalidation. Price and stock updates publish to the `catalog-changes` stream, and the Sweepfern worker evicts affected keys within roughly two seconds. Full-category invalidations are rate-limited to avoid stampedes, so bulk imports may show stale data briefly. If you observe persistent staleness beyond five minutes, notify the catalog platform team at the address below.

alerts address for bajop-yahog: istwyn@lumiclabs.internal

## Migration Step 4: Deep-link routing cut-over

For this week's sync: the Ferngate mobile apps now route deep links through the new Lanternway resolver instead of the legacy in-app switch. Old link formats are rewritten at the edge for two release cycles, after which they 404. QA has verified the top fifty link patterns; long-tail patterns are logged for review. Before enabling the resolver in your environment, confirm the routing service is deployed with the configuration values shown below.

service settings:
[casax]
port = 6379
team = rusir
host = casax.zemvarhq.corp
region = outer-4
access_code = ac_9808ce
timeout_ms = 1500